Natural vs. Sweetening Agents: What's the Distinction?
Comprehending the kinds of sugar chemicals in your diet plan brings about a crucial difference in between all-natural and fabricated sugar. All-natural sugar, like honey and syrup, originated from plants and consist of nutrients and anti-oxidants. They're minimally processed and frequently supply a more complicated flavor account. On the various other hand, sweetening agents, such as aspartame and sucralose, are chemically manufactured and do not supply the very same nutritional advantages. They're commonly used in low-calorie products to change sugar while keeping sweetness.
While all-natural sweeteners can elevate blood sugar degrees, they generally do so much more slowly. Man-made sugar, in contrast, can be much sweeter than sugar, usually leading you to long for more sugary foods.

Typical Sugar Synonyms
Sugar lurks in many refined foods under different names, making it essential for you to understand what to look for. When scanning ingredient lists, watch out for typical sugar basic synonyms like high-fructose corn syrup, cane sugar, and corn syrup. You could likewise come across terms like sucrose, sugar, and fructose. Various other stealthy names include maltose, dextrose, and agave nectar. Even components like honey and molasses load a sugary punch. Do not ignore vaporized walking stick juice and fruit juice concentrates, which often show up healthier but still contribute to your sugar consumption. Being conscious of these terms encourages you to make informed options and avoid covert sugars that can thwart your dietary objectives. Remain cautious, and review those labels very carefully!
